Tony Wright (born 6 May 1968) is the lead singer of the UK band Terrorvision and also the band Laika Dog.

Leigh Brooks directs this documentary which follows British rock band Terrorvision as they embark on a UK tour to celebrate the 20th anniversary of their hit album 'Regular Urban Survivors'. The film features behind-the-scenes footage, interviews with the band and live performance footage from the tour.
